The article presents key principles for building high-performance applications using Tokio, focusing on best practices for async/await, minimizing overhead, and efficient resource utilization.
Background
Tokio is a leading async runtime for Rust, widely used for network services and concurrent applications. This article provides practical guidance for developers aiming to optimize performance.
